Great game. Great win. Great feeling. Some thoughts:

- Clifford is a machine. Great kicking game but also brings great kick chase and defensive effort to the side. Looks like he is almost the perfect partner for Pearce. Made our biggest weakness (fifth tackle options and attacking kick threat) into one of our biggest weapons. His defense, enthusiasm and effort has also been superb since the minute he got here.

- Ponga really is THAT good. Whenever he is out for a couple of weeks, I forget how good he is. I forget how good one player can actually be. Only took 3 minutes to remind me and everyone else how good he is. I want him to stick around forever.

- Saifitis starting and Klemmer off the bench is something we should stick with for the rest of the season. How fired up is Klemmer when he comes off the bench? In his first defensive set, he hunted down their kicker with a real mean look on his face. It was damn intimidating. Good to see. Made some massive carriers throughout the game as well.

- Fitz needs a couple of really big games soon or Jones is going to take his spot. Jones makes a lot less errors and is a much stronger defender. I hope we resigned him on near minimum contract money only.

- Tuala is getting better and better each game. I think left centre suits him much better than playing on the right. Didn't do anything wrong and had some strong carries. Is he resigned?

- Very happy with our wingers. Dom Young is raw but is bursting with potential. Strong, quick and great in the air. Seems to have some awareness about his game as well. Set up Ponga for his two tries tonight. Ponga returned the favor with class though. Hunt has been severely missed all season. Solid carries out of our half, safe under the bomb and his defensive reads are first class. The Cowboys spine couldn't find a way to outsmart Hunt's defensive nous.

- Mann was pretty decent. Mann for $300k a season or Gagai for $600k, I'd take Mann in a heartbeat.

- Watson: sign the man up. Looks like he is over his injury worries. Offers that something different. A light weight Brandon Smith. Offers excellent impact off the bench, can play the link role, can back up well on line breaks, strong carries for a small man and does not miss a tackle. Add to the fact that he covers hooker, lock, centre, half and fullback, he is integral to how we play.

- Probably missed out on a ton of stuff I wanted to say but so happy with the win. I would say that the competition is clearly divided with the top teams definitely a league above the lower teams. However, I think at full strength, we might be that one side who is between the top and bottom teams. We should definitely be in the finals this year. If we make it, we will give a lot of the top teams a run for their money. Let's keep everyone fit, get Frizzell back and give the Storm a real good game.

Agree with most of this, but can't understand the Fitz/Jones comment.

Really feel like this is mostly about expectations. Fitz resigned at future-origin level money, and hasn't lived up to it. Jones was an afterthought, and has been better than that.

But if you step away from money, Fitz is a better defender, a more dangerous line runner, does just as much of the 1%ers (watch a kick pressure or a kick chase, don't just remember the two big efforts from Jones earlier in the year) and is an overall much better athlete. It isn't coincidence when he came back from injury, he walked back into the starting side, whereas Jones can't get more than 20 minutes when the team is fully fit.

Someone please explain to me where the love for Jones comes from, I can't understand it. Other than he's a local junior who made a couple of impactful plays when he first came into grade. Love the effort, but he's very limited.
